WHERE DID THE MONEY GO?

Between 2008 and 2016 Haitian government officials and members of the business elite misused or outright embezzled an estimated two billion USD from the discount oil-purchasing program known as PetroCaribe. According to reports released by Haiti’s Superior Court of Auditors, funds which were slated to support development efforts were instead diverted towards no-bid government contracts, shell companies, and projects that were never completed.

With a rallying cry of “Kot kòb PetroCaribe a” / “Where is the PetroCaribe money?” young activists in Haiti have mobilized online and in the streets since 2018 to demand an investigation and trial for those incriminated in one of the largest corruption scandals in Haitian history.
